Three Cornered Pond–Kamesit Road Loop, 3 sights is a 3.5-mile loop in Myles Standish State Forest near South Pond, MA. The route reaches Three Cornered Pond. It is mostly level, with 167 ft of elevation gain, and mostly dirt. It scores 66/100 on the Ambleway Wildness scale: backcountry feel.

Parking lot at the trailhead

  1. Start on Three Corners Pond Road, heading W.
  2. 0.4 miPass Three Cornered Pond.
  3. 0.8 miSharp right onto Kamesit Road, heading W.
  4. 0.5 miBear right, heading N.
  5. 350 ftTurn right onto Torrey Pond Road, heading N.
  6. 1.2 miBear right, heading NE.
  7. 0.4 miTurn left onto Three Corners Pond Road, heading SE.
  8. 450 ftThe loop closes back at the trailhead.

Each distance is the walk from the previous step. Tap a step for a map of its junction.
